Key DifferencesSony DR-BTN200B uses Bluetooth 3.0 while Zebronics Zeb-Sound Bomb Q Pro supports Bluetooth 5.0, which can impact connectivity stability and efficiency. Battery life varies between the two (Music Playtime: 40 hr, Talk Time: 30 hr, Standby Time: 800 hr vs 6~8 Hours), which affects how long you can use them on a single charge. The driver size differs between the two (30 mm vs 6 mm), which can influence sound depth, bass response, and overall audio clarity. Impedance levels vary (NA vs 16 ohm), which can affect compatibility and audio output when used with different devices. Sony DR-BTN200B and Zebronics Zeb-Sound Bomb Q Pro are premium wireless headphones designed to deliver high-quality sound along with advanced features like noise cancellation and long battery life. The frequency response differs (10 - 24,000Hz vs 20 Hz - 20000 Hz), which can influence how well the headphones reproduce lows, mids, and highs. In general, both options are suitable for everyday use including music, calls, travel, and work-from-home scenarios. There is a noticeable difference in weight (157 g (included rechargeable battery) vs 52 Gm), which may affect comfort during extended use. Sony DR-BTN200B and Zebronics Zeb-Sound Bomb Q Pro offer different noise cancellation capabilities (No vs NA), which can impact how effectively they block external noise.
